What Is the Meaning of a Sparrow Tattoo?
Tattoos have been a popular form of self-expression for centuries, and one design that has gained significant popularity is the sparrow tattoo. These tiny birds hold symbolic meaning across different cultures and are often chosen as a tattoo design for their aesthetic appeal and the profound messages they convey. In this article, we will explore the meaning behind a sparrow tattoo and delve into five interesting facts about these captivating creatures.
The sparrow has long been associated with freedom, love, and loyalty. It is a symbol of resilience and triumph over adversity, making it a popular choice for those who have overcome challenging life experiences. Additionally, sparrows are known for their strong social bonds and their ability to navigate and adapt to various environments. Therefore, a sparrow tattoo may also symbolize the importance of family and friendship.

5. Do sparrows hold different meanings in different cultures?
Yes, sparrows hold various symbolic meanings across different cultures. For example, in Chinese culture, sparrows are associated with joy and happiness, while in Native American cultures, they symbolize protection and guidance.
